1. The principle and function of anti-aliasing

Anti-aliasing algorithmically adds semi-transparent pixels to the edges of images, blurring jagged staircase effects and making lines and outlines smoother. The following are its core functions:
| function | Description |
|---|---|
| Anti-aliasing | Improve the "step-like" pixel feel at the lower edge of low resolutions |
| Improve clarity | Reduce picture flicker and distortion, especially suitable for dynamic scenes |
| Enhance immersion | Make environments and character models more natural in the game |
2. Comparison of common types of anti-aliasing
Different anti-aliasing technologies have their own advantages and disadvantages. The following is a comparison of mainstream solutions:
| Type | Principle | Performance consumption | Applicable scenarios |
|---|---|---|---|
| MSAA (Multiple Sampling) | Blend multiple samples of edge pixels | in | 3D games, static images |
| FXAA (fast approximation) | Full screen post-processing blur | low | High speed action game |
| TAA (temporality) | Leverage inter-frame data optimization | Middle to high | Dynamic light and shadow scenes |
| DLSS/FSR (AI super resolution) | AI reconstructs high-resolution images | Depends on hardware | 4K and above resolution |

3. Global system settings (NVIDIA/AMD graphics card)
| steps | NVIDIA control panel | AMD Radeon settings |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Right click on desktop to open control panel | Right-click on the desktop and select "AMD Software" |
| 2 | Go to "3D Settings" > "Manage 3D Settings" | Navigate to Graphics > Advanced |
| 3 | Select Global Settings or Individual Program Configuration | Turn on "morphological filtering" or "MLAA" |
